Somewhere in England is an album by George Harrison, released in 1981. Recorded as Harrison was becoming increasingly frustrated with the music industry, the album's making was a long one, and witnessed a tragic event in Harrison's life.
Content to move at his own speed, Harrison began recording Somewhere In England in the autumn of 1979 and would continue at a sporadic pace, finally delivering the album to Warner Bros. Records in September 1980. However, the powers that be at Warner Bros. rejected it, ordering Harrison to drop four of its songs ("Tears Of The World", "Sat Singing", "Lay His Head" and "Flying Hour") which they found too downbeat. Track listing: All songs by George Harrison, except where noted. 1. "Blood from A Clone" – 4:03 2. "Unconsciousness Rules" – 3:35 3. "Life Itself" – 4:25 4. "All Those Years Ago" – 3:45 * Harrison's tribute to John Lennon, featuring Ringo Starr on drums, as well as Paul and Linda McCartney and Denny Laine on backing vocals 5. "Baltimore Oriole" (Hoagy Carmichael) – 3:57 6. "Teardrops" – 4:07 7. "That Which I Have Lost" – 3:47 8. "Writing's On The Wall" – 3:59 9. "Hong Kong Blues" (Hoagy Carmichael) – 2:55 10. "Save The World" – 4:54 * the track's end features a short excerpt from "Crying", originally released on Harrison's 1968 debut album Wonderwall Music Original track listing 1. "Hong Kong Blues" 2. "Writings On The Wall" 3. "Flying Hour" (Harrison/Ralphs) 4. "Lay His Head" 5. "Unconsciousness Rules" 6. "Sat Singing" 7. "Life Itself" 8. "Tears Of The World" 9. "Baltimore Oriole" 10. "Save The World" | |||||||||||||||
